Prey Sar’s Grip on Opposition Tightens

Opposition party member Um Sam An, who is under investigation on charges of allegedly faking documents to accuse the government of ceding land to Vietnam, is now being held in solitary custody, unable to meet or talk with other detainees, according to senior Cambodian National Rescue Party (CNRP) official Son Chhay. Speaking to reporters after a visit to Prey Sar prison yesterday, Mr. Chhay said that while Mr. Sam An, who has yet to be found guilty of any offense and is being held in Prey Sar awaiting trial, now has no health problems, he was being treated different from other detainees. In addition to being not allowed to speak to other detainees, Mr. Sam An is followed by a prison detail at all times.

“This is an irregularity, the way Sam An is treated. He is the first and only lawmaker in Cambodia to be detained despite his parliamentary immunity. I think the assembly must look into this and give an explanation,” Mr. Chhay said, referring to the judicial immunity granted to all Cambodian lawmakers regardless of party affiliation. Nuth Savna, a spokesman for the Interior Ministry’s General Department of Prisons, said the measures were in the interest of Mr. Sam An’s safety.

“There are more than 4,000 detainees in Prey Sar prison and the number of guards we have is limited. We are doing this just to protect him. That is not a restriction on his freedom. What if someone mistreated him or he had a problem? We would have trouble and that would lead to allegations of political harm or something,” Mr. Savna said. On Friday last week, Prime Minister Hun Sen said during a cabinet meeting that the arrest of Mr. Sam An was legal, as he incited conflict between the Kingdom and a neighboring country and therefore ceded his right to immunity.
